Best canyons around Strengen are found within the Stanzertal valley, a region characterized by its impressive natural landscape and steep slopes carved by the Rosanna river. This topography creates numerous gorges and ravines suitable for exploration. The area offers diverse outdoor activities, including canyoning, which combines elements of hiking, swimming, and abseiling through water-carved passages. Visitors can experience deeply cut gorge sections and natural water features from an intimate, water-level perspective.

Lu
August 9, 2024, Schnanner Klamm

Currently only accessible up to the dam due to the risk of falling rocks. Still nice to walk, even if only partially. There is also an alternative route for the Fritzhütte. If you are only coming for the gorge, you should definitely ask at the tourist information office beforehand whether the closure is still in place. As of August 9, 2024

The climb is relatively steep on the western slope of the Seekogel. Part of the path is very comfortable and safe in the form of wooden steps. In the upper part, the path leads below very beautiful waterfalls in a small gorge to the high plateau of the Memminger Hut. Below the waterfalls, many ibexes could be seen in the immediate vicinity of the hiking trail. An impressive experience.

Frequently Asked Questions

What types of natural gorges can I explore around Strengen?

The Strengen area, nestled in the Stanzertal valley, is characterized by its impressive natural landscape and steep slopes carved by the Rosanna river. This topography has created numerous deeply cut gorges and ravines. You can explore narrow water-carved passages, impressive rock walls, and areas featuring natural water slides and crystal-clear pools. Notable examples include Schnanner Gorge, where you navigate stone and metal steps through narrow passages, and Urgtal Valley, which offers a wonderful alternative tour along a stream.

Are there opportunities for canyoning near Strengen?

Yes, the Stanzertal region and surrounding Tyrolean Oberland are ideal for canyoning. This activity combines elements of hiking, swimming, climbing, and abseiling through water-carved gorges. Local providers offer guided canyoning tours, allowing participants to explore pristine gorges, navigate rushing falls, and experience the region's natural beauty from a unique, water-level perspective. Tours are available for various skill levels, from beginners to advanced enthusiasts.

Are there any specific tips for exploring the gorges, such as safety or access?

When exploring gorges, especially those with challenging terrain like Schnanner Gorge, it's important to be aware of conditions. Some sections may be temporarily closed due to rockfall risk, so it's always wise to inquire at local tourist information offices beforehand. For canyoning, professional guides are highly recommended, as they provide necessary equipment and ensure safety. Always wear appropriate footwear and clothing, and be prepared for varying weather conditions.
